Surveying storm damage in Middlesex and Hunterdon counties

Severe storms on Tuesday night knocked down trees and power lines.

Strong storms rolled through Middlesex County Tuesday night bringing down some very large trees including in Edison’s Roosevelt Park.
Several large trees were brought down, and some are sitting on power lines.
Meanwhile, in Hunterdon County, several trees and large branches were brought down in Flemington.
A large tree came down on some wires there as well. Fortunately no injuries were reported.
Thousands are without power this morning as crews work to restore those affected.
